SANTO DOMINGO - Dominican Republic had a good showing against Uruguay in a friendly match held this Friday at the Bukit Jalil National Stadium in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ia, as part of the FIFA date in September. Despite this, the Quisqueyan team fell by the minimum difference 1-0.

The Dominican Selection stood up to the two-time world champion and was close to obtaining a positive result with the presence of 7,777 fans.
Dominicana warned from the first minute with Junior Firpo's service from the left for Dorny Romero, who rose well, but the rival goalkeeper anticipated the aerial pass.
The Uruguayans had a dangerous opportunity at the 11th minute when a low pass from the left wing came out, which Luciano Rodríguez shot first time wide.
When half an hour of the match had been played, Romero intercepted a pass in his own territory and through the central corridor, which originated an important counterattack alongside Edarlyn Reyes on the left flank, but the final pass for Dorny was a bit behind, which prevented the one-on-one with Cristopher Fiermarín.
The Sedofútbol rounded off a first half without complications, however, at 40’ the celeste had a couple of opportunities that were resolved by the Quisqueyan goalkeeper Xavier Valdéz. Oscar Ureña would respond with a good play in attack in which he ended up shooting from the balcony of the area, but head-on to the rival goalkeeper.
With the goalless parity they would go to the break and the Dominican Republic with the feeling that they could have achieved something more in that first half.
In the start of the complement -minute 49’- Heinz Morschel stole a ball on the right lane of the first Uruguayan zone, passed it to Ureña who made a filtered pass to the area, but the defense cleared it to the corner kick. Two minutes later Morschel himself shot at the goal from a free kick, but the ball went over the crossbar.
At the 61st minute, Ignacio Laquintana entered the Quisqueyan area from the right sector and put his team ahead with a cross shot at mid-height.
Ronaldo Vásquez, who had entered in the second half, showed his quality to evade the Uruguayan left-back and enter the rival penalty area, taking a cross and low shot that was slightly deflected by a defender, stifling the Dominican Republic's goal cry at 69'.
Around the 73rd minute, Juan Familia arrived from the left and delivered a ground pass that Erick Japa could have finished, but it went wide.
Despite the good presentation, the Dominican Republic could not find the goal that would allow them to equalize the scoreboard and avoid defeat against the South American team.
The Dominican Republic National Team's next matches will be next November in Santiago de los Caballeros.
